Russia will be hosting the 21st FIFA World Cup this summer from June 14 to July 15.

Thirty-two teams qualified for the event including Germany (four-time champions), the champions of the 2014 FIFA World Cup. Brazil (five-time champions), Argentina (two- time champions), Spain (one- time champions), France (one-time champions), Netherlands, and Switzerland are also among the teams who qualified for the World Cup.

An important team to notice is Italy (four-time champions) who did not qualify this year.  This will be the first time since 1958 that they have not played.

The United States lost against Trinidad and Tobago 2 to 1, disqualifying them from the World Cup. This will be the first time since 1986 that the US will not be playing in the event. However, this will be the first year in 40 years that Trinidad and Tobago will be playing in the World Cup.

The first match will be Russia vs Saudi Arabia on June 14.
